How leaders can efficiently handle dispute on a staff

.Every year, united state firms shed $359 billion in performance to conflict in between employees. While healthy problems can easily improve advancement and creative thinking, left out of hand they can likewise stop partnership, cut into productivity, and even injure employees' psychological as well as physical health.Yet regardless of these expenses, several forerunners problem to also refer to it. Specifically in companies along with lifestyles that focus on "helping make great," avoiding dispute can easily come to be therefore normalized that managers and also workers as well find yourself hanging around much also lengthy to recognize as well as resolve disputes on their groups. Because of this, solvable complications gather, slight disagreements boil over into primary encounters, as well as inevitably each employees as well as their institutions suffer.The excellent updates is, these conflict-avoidant lifestyles may change. Via my thirty years operating as an exec and crew instructor for Luck 500 providers and also start-ups, I've recognized four essential approaches to help leaders beat an inclination to stay away from disagreement, welcome well-balanced argument, and inspire their crews to perform the very same:1. Recognize and organize very likely aspects of conflictWhile problem might seem to be unpredictable, it can, as a matter of fact, be actually forecasted much like any other functional danger aspect. Because of this, just like companies think about brand-new innovation rollouts, field switches, or company reorganizations, so, as well, can easily they determine activities that are actually likely to generate conflict-- as well as plan in advance accordingly.Common activities that have a tendency to trigger dispute feature technical advancements that upend people's tasks and sense useful to the organization, advertisings or even sequence programs that cause a previous peer ending up being a boss (as well as therefore possibly sparking concealed bitterness), or even quick group development that muddies task breakdowns and leaves individuals along with additional duty than they have the capacity to handle. When forerunners pinpoint these likely aspects of dispute, they can proactively manage open discussions along with the employees as well as groups probably to be influenced. In this way, instead of letting people be actually blindsided by dispute, innovators may ensure that groups understand potential concerns and develop space for people to sky various opinions and also review prospective solutions before the dispute escalates.For instance, I partnered with a midsize biopharma business that was preparing a critical change toward launching a lot more clinical researches while lessening its scientific discovery initiatives. While this improvement was needed for the provider to grow, a lot of its staff members were actually unfamiliar with the extensive resources called for to ramp up scientific trials-- a change that was likely to substantially affect folks's do work in methods several could not recognize or even foresee.With inflection factors that include very likely uncertainties, disagreement conveniently emerges. Through forecasting these sources of dispute, the organization was able to proactively inform the impacted teams on rebalancing medical breakthrough and also clinical initiatives, resources, as well as top priorities. Management took opportunity for a series of cross-functional appointments to aid crews expect issues as well as explain exactly how they will work through them. Prioritization was covered as a team, and workers were enabled to come up with services before complications even developed. Consequently, instead of being shocked when disagreements surfaced, the organization managed to act preemptively via convenient and well-timed talks.2. Invite a neutral partner to uncover conflictWhen staff members disagree along with their managers, understandably they may hesitate to speak out, even if leadership explicitly asks them to. Because of this, leaders are frequently the final ones to understand when a disagreement has been actually cooking. To address this, a neutral 3rd party can easily function as a valuable partner in turning up disputes and also pressing folks to share differing opinions.Research has shown that crews usually help when someone is appointed to become a "unorthodox," or to make waves as well as press the group to explore new ideas. Inviting a person coming from outside the team-- whether a counted on coach, a worker from another staff, or an outside specialist-- to explore possible resources of disagreement may be an effective way to make sure that folks share the hidden concerns they might be harboring.I have actually seen this many times in my own expertise. In one scenario, I worked with a CFO that was enticed that the exec team needed to refocus on key concerns through reducing the number of appointments they secured. No person appeared to push on the concept, as well as she rapidly initiated a meeting reduction planning. However as soon as the CFO left the area, the primary growth officer piped up along with a sturdy difference. She felt that since the firm was presently scaling down, it was actually specifically essential for the manager group to obtain "in the weeds," consequently she contended that reducing on meetings was a dangerous move. I promptly encouraged the development police officer to discuss her worry about the economic officer, and also while the conversation between the managers started as a disagreement, they were actually quickly able to get to a compromise. Considering that I was an outsider, the CGO agreed to speak out in front of me, making it achievable to deliver a conflict to lighting that the CFO would certainly typically have been completely not aware of.3. Stabilize experimentationAs teams as well as organizations advance, rules around problem and also interaction will inevitably must grow also. Rather than deciding on a technique to dealing with problem and after that never ever revisiting it once again, reliable innovators take advantage of the uncertainty of the modern company world through constructing lifestyles that normalize testing on an ongoing basis.For circumstances, a laid-back standup meeting that assisted a 10-person startup sky its complaints might certainly not be the best dispute management resource when it grows into a 200-person company. An abrupt interaction style that motivates seminar in one circumstance might falter when a business acquires a service with a less direct society. To progress of brand new sources of problem, it is actually essential to place bodies right into spot that guarantee constant experimentation along with as well as analysis of brand new approaches to oppose management.Of program, this will look different in different organizations. I dealt with one global pharmaceutical customer that was battling to adapt to rapid growth as the need for a runaway success drug increased. The human resources group, doubtful about modifying procedures that had worked for many years, began to butt heads along with legal, who favored new methods as well as significantly looked down on human resources as less business savvy. Animosity and also be wary of rapidly festered in to heated conflict.In my partner with leaders, experiments started with cross-functional team communications. Substituting monthly, hour-long meetings along with pair of weekly, 15-minute check-ins substantially strengthened communication between human resources and lawful. Leaders trying out the strategy of sharing one communal trouble to initiate the appointment, then seeking staff ideas for remedies. Quickly cross-team interaction went through the roof, tasks and also handoffs no longer fell through the gaps. By means of a determination to experiment and repeat on well-known job practices, a worst-case dispute situation was actually averted.4. Create area for personal valuesWhen our experts consider values at the workplace, we usually jump to firm values: those verbose checklists of corporate slang that you may possess listed on your website or even glued on the workplace wall surface. To make sure, these corporate worths belong. Yet when browsing problem, it's vital to make space for the unique personal values that each specific brings to the table, instead of thinking that everyone allotments a set of general, company-approved excellents. For instance, one employee may value tough commonplace and taking risks while an additional worths security and also reliability, which might cause disagreements over strategy advancement, punishment, problem-solving, and also decision-making. Generally, dispute emerges (and hangs around over the long run) when individuals's profoundly kept individual worths continue to be unmentioned as well as, as a result, are actually inadvertently gone against. These infractions destroy trust fund, bring in people that a lot less very likely to face the problem and eventually stimulating a vicious circle in which conflict persists, goes unaddressed, and also remains to grow.To short-circuit this pattern, innovators should operate to recognize the personal values that root the problems on their staffs. After all, it is our most heavily stored views that shape our actions as well as emotions, and so it is actually simply by engaging along with them that leaders may intend to resolve social problems. While concentrating on corporate worths can in some cases feel like bit more than a proverb or superficial condolence, exploring folks's personal worths will certainly both equip forerunners to get to the center of the matter as well as help them create rely on and mutual understanding, essentially paving the way for more real and long-lasting resolutions. As an example, in my work with management teams, I regularly carry out a personal market values work out early, taking another look at the leading analysis as well as insights throughout my partner with the team. This crucial measure areas worths as leaders' much less visible motivators. These unspoken yet effective influencers mold our assumptions of others, push vital selections, and also determine whether or not our team are truly accessible to listen closely to varying points of view. This awareness aids management teams pitch in to beneficial market values, court others less, value each other more, and accomplish much better results via willful chats. Managing problem is actually hard. It may be disorganized, annoying, and also unpleasant. Because of this, it is actually logical that so many forerunners make an effort to avoid it. And also yet, neglecting conflict doesn't create it go away-- it only makes it worse. By using the approaches above, forerunners can easily develop crews that comprehend problem rather than dreading it, as well as who are actually readied to acknowledge and resolve their arguments head on.
